Rome, Italy – April 2024 – Students from the Institute of Spiritual Theology of the Pontifical Salesian University (UPS) who specialise in the history and spirituality of St John Bosco visited the offices and archives of the Postulation for the Causes of Saints of the Salesian   on 9 April. They did so as part of the course/ seminar on the holiness of the Salesian Family. They were accompanied by Fr Gabriel Cruz Trejo, collaborator of the Postulator Fr Pierluigi Cameroni, and Spiritual Animator for the primary ADMA. In Salesian Studies curriculum, students delve into various aspects of the history, spirituality and pedagogy of St John Bosco. Taken into account are aspects of the spirituality and history of St Francis de Sales, of St Mary Mazzarello, of the groups of the Salesian Family, of Salesian pedagogy and the preventive system, of Don Bosco's spiritual proposal for young people, the development of the Salesian Congregation. During the seminar on the holiness of the Salesian Family, students learn about the progress of the processes leading to canonisation; together they study the case of Don Bosco's canonisation. Students from Japan, Angola, Papua New Guinea, India and Congo, individually delve into the case of one of the holy candidates: Blesseds, Venerables and  Servants of God of the Salesian Family. A tradition that has disappeared for some years has thus been recovered thanks to the new headquarters at the Zefferino Namuncurá community in Via della Bufalotta in Rome, a few kilometres from the UPS.

Torre Annunziata, Italy – March 2024 - Twenty years since the murder of Matilde Sorrentino, twenty years of life of "Mamma Matilde" Childrens Community in Torre Annunziata and the"Small steps, big dreams" Association who are members of Salesians for Social Matilde Sorrentino was a woman and a mother from Torre Annunziata (Naples), who in 1997 denounced a pedophile ring in her son's school. He was also a victim of abuse. In 2004, she was killed, shot in front of her son. In that same year we were finishing the work of the "Small steps big dreams" in the childrens community in Torre Annunziata. "It seemed right to us to call it Mamma Matilde: here we welcome many young people who do not have a mother and we have chosen to make Matilde Sorrentino ‘enter’ the community with her courage, her dignity and her practicality", explains Rino Balzano, social worker in the Community. A few days before Matilda's murder, Annalisa Durante was killed in Naples. Twenty years later, the Salesians in Torre Annunziata wanted to remember Annalisa and Matilde with two conferences. The first, on 22 March with young people from the communities and the oratory at Torre Annunziata who met some relatives of the victims and at the end gave rise to a procession to Matilde's house. On 26 March, the Salesian house in Torre Annunziata hosted the conference twenty years after the death of Matilde Sorrentino to keep the memory of ‘Mamma Courage’ alive. It was sponsored by the Municipality of Torre Annunziata, involving various personalities, during which the story of Matilde was remembered and the importance of the work of anti-violence centres was stressed.

(ANS – Catania) – The "Educational poverty: the Salesian presence and proposal in Sicily" Conference was held on Saturday, 6 April at the Don Bosco theatre in the Salesian Institute at Cibali, in Catania, promoted by the Salesians of the Saint Paul Province of Sicily (ISI) and by the Sicilian Territorial Committee of "Salesians for Social APS". At the end of the conference, this committee held its own meeting in order to renew its commitment and qualified dedication to the service of its beneficiaries.
